This didn't sound right, so I did the math. The volume of all water is 1,386,000,000 km^3, which is then 1.386e+21 liters, or right about the same number of kilograms. The mass of Earth is about 5.972e+24 kg. So the percent fraction by mass is 0.0232%. A "drop" is typically estimated at 1/20th of one mL, which is then 0.05 grams. We can estimate the mass of a small-ish bowling ball at 5kg, or 5000 grams. 0.05 / 5000…
You'd have to use the volume of earth, not the mass. Google tells me that lava is ~3x denser than water.
Earth as a whole has a density about 5.5x that of water.
